Research strengths

The School of Mathematical Sciences has a long and proud history of research across the broad spectrum of Pure Mathematics, Applied Mathematics and Statistics. It is one of the leading Mathematics schools in Australia, hosting a number of prestigious Australian Research Council Professorial Fellows.
